Sometimes we all need a little fibery treat... I ordered a new Grizzly Mountain Arts Bead Spindle recently and it came on Friday! You can see her there second from the left... all shiny and ready to go!
Of course I couldn't help but get started on a new spin... to use her and some of my other favorite spindles.
I love my spindle collection... and while I know I really don't *need* any more... sometimes I just can't help it. They're like magic wands! Each one has a personality and specific talents. As you can see, they come in basically every shape and size imaginable. This handful is by a number of talented artisans:
Left to right: Phil Powell - Bubinga with Swarovsky Crystal; Grizzly Mountain Arts - Cherry Maple Dymondwood Bead Spindle; Magical Moons - maple Russian; Bristlecone - Outlander Glindle; Grizzly Mountain Arts - Alternative Ivory Druid Egg; Bristlecone - Emerald Twindle
The fiber is absolutely gorgeous too... a nice soft Merino Wool dyed by Ginny at FatCatKnits. It's a gradient called "Dragonfly" in vibrant and glowing colors. My plan is to strip it into two portions and spin from Purple, through blue and teal, and into lime green. I want to end up with a two ply, light lace, and probably knit it into something either circular or into a rectangular stole. Something that shows off the beautiful colors and transition.
